4-disc Insert :D
yuFuinc.jpg


Grab the spine with one hand
94CuUpr.jpg


With the other, grab the top corner while placing your thumb on the other edge (the opening side) and push it away from you
reOwcIK.jpg


Heat up the spine to loosen the adhesive. You can use a hair dryer. I used my 3D printer's heated bed at 70C
350qK6u.jpg


Gently lift the edge of the spine with a razor blade and gently slide it down the length of the spine
h19ye5R.jpg


After cleaning the spine on the case and spine from adhesive (Goo-Gone or rubbing alcohol) use 6mm tape applied to the spine to stick it to the new shell.
BwmJtEa.jpg


Stick the spine onto the new plastic case, and slip the covers back on.
